115,955 is a composite number, odd.
115,955 (one hundred fifteen thousand nine hundred fifty-five) is an odd 6-digit number. It is a composite number with 8 divisors, and factors as 5 × 7 × 3,313. Written other ways, in hexadecimal, 0x1C4F3.
